802.11 管理机制

来源:互联网 发布:暗黑法术工厂升级数据 编辑:程序博客网 时间:2024/06/05 14:31

802.11帧:数据帧、控制帧、管理帧。

数据帧:搬运数据。(分为用于基于竞争的服务、用于无竞争服务)

控制帧:通常与数据帧搭配使用,负责区域清空、信道取得以及载波监听的维护,并于收到正确数据时予以确认。

管理帧:负责监督,主要用来加入或退出无线网络以及处理接入点之间的关联的转移事宜。

数据帧中,无竞争周期所传递的任何帧必须将Duration字段设定为32768,适用于无竞争周期所传递的任何帧。对于广播和组播而言,Duration 为0。对于组播和广播,此类帧并非原子交换过程的一部分,接收端不会加以确认。如果Frame Control 字段中More Fragments 位为0,表示该帧已无其余片段。

网络类型会影响地址字段的用法。

在802.11中,工作站以MAC地址作为身份证明(因为MAC地址独一无二)。

身份验证算法标识:0代表开放系统认证方式,1代表使用共享密钥身份验证。

共享密钥身份验证:理论基础,如果能成功响应传给它的质询信息,就证明工作站拥有共享密钥。

预先身份验证:用来加速关联转移,即工作站转移至新的接入点。预先身份验证(在扫描阶段进行)实质就是将身份验证和关联分开操作,防止造成延迟(完整的EAP认证费时)。

关联(建立路由关系):建立移动式工作站与接入点之间的对应关系,工作站只能与一个接入点形成关联,如此,发给移动式工作站的帧才会转送至其所属的接入点。(只限于基础结构型网络)同时,生成AID。

重新关联:当工作站从某个接入点的涵盖范围内转移至另一个接入点时,就会重新关联过程。

IBSS:独立基本服务集。BSSID:基本服务集标识符(所有位均为1的BSSID称为广播型BSSID)。只用隶属同一个BSS工作站才会处理该广播或组播信息。

在infrastructure BSS(基础结构型基本服务集)中,BSSID 就是创建该BSS的接入点上无线接口的MAC地址。

接入点有两项与电源管理相关的任务,其一,接入点知道所关联的每个工作站的电源管理状态(休眠/唤醒),其二,定期的声明有帧待传的工作站(TIM 传输指示映射)。

TIM本身是一虚拟位映射表,并且,TIM每位与特定的AID对应,设定与特定AID相应的位,代表接入点为该AID所对应的工作站缓存了单播帧。(AID:关联标识符,与具体的工作站关联)。要获取基站所缓存的帧,移动式工作站可以使用PS-Poll控制帧。如果缓存的帧不只一个,Frame Control(帧控制)字段的More Data为1,可以据此发送额外的PS-Poll帧,直到More Data 位为0。每个PS-Poll帧只能获取一个缓存帧。

PS-Poll帧:用以指示某个处于省电状态的移动式工作站暂时切换为活跃模式,并且准备接收被缓存的帧。

聆听间隔:工作站与接入点之间的一项契约。

DTIM:延迟传输指示映射,用于缓存传递组播与广播帧。

independent 网络中的工作站使用ATIM(通知传输指示数据指示消息),有时也称为特设数据指示消息,强调其他工作站保持清醒。在同一个IBSS中,所有工作站都必须在Beancon传送后的特定期间内聆听ATIM帧。

infrastructure 网络的定时同步:与接入点关联的工作站从所获得的Beacon 帧(timestamp)中取得。


传输功率控制(TPC),优点:避免接入点之间产生重叠,改善整体的吞吐量,延长电池的使用时间(避免干扰5G的雷达系统)。

Beacon帧中的Country信息元素指定最大管制功率。Power Constraint 信息元素用来指定网络可以使用的最大传输功率。

Power Capability信息元素中提供最小与最大传输功率。

无线链路测量:工作站发送Action帧要求提供传输报告,Action帧中包含了一个TPC Report 信息元素,其中有两项描述性的统计数据(路径损耗、链路边界值)。

动态选频(DFS,选频就是切换信道):目的避免干扰雷达系统及将功率开展到所有可用信道。Association Request 帧中包含Supported Channels 信息元素,其中列出工作站支持的信道。基础结构型网络与独立型网络的信道切换有所区别,因独立型网络没有中枢单元,后者由DFS owner 工作站实现信道切换。

信道静默(顾名思义,停止所有传输操作):无线信道测试是在静默周期或静默间隔中进行。静默周期是由Beacon 与Probe Response 帧中的Quite信息元素进行安排。

无线信道测量:通过Measurement Request 帧发送请求,是否支持请求由硬件决定。

Action帧:要求工作站采取必要的动作。

Measurement Request 帧:用来请求工作站进行测量并将结果返回。与之对应的是Mesurement Report 帧,用来发送测量结果给提出请求者。

CCA:空闲信道评估。

RPI:(RPI柱状图)用于汇报接收口收到的功率的分布情况。







0 0
原创粉丝点击